How Can Lack of Sleep Impact My Health and Productivity?
Insomnia doesn’t just leave you feeling tired—it can disrupt your mental clarity, emotional balance, and even physical health. Sleep deprivation can make you more susceptible to mood disorders like anxiety and depression, as well as contribute to chronic conditions such as heart disease or diabetes. Treating insomnia is crucial not only for improving sleep but for enhancing your overall well-being.
What Makes Insomnia So Difficult to Treat on My Own?
Sleep issues are rarely just about “getting to bed earlier.” Insomnia is often a complex condition with underlying emotional or physiological causes, including anxiety, depression, or stress. Tackling these factors through professional care is often the only way to break the cycle of sleeplessness.
